- Competitive salary + bonus- Australia New South Wales Sydney- Permanent- Alternative & Renewable Energy**Role description**:
As Community Engagement Manager, you will provide community engagement and stakeholder management services in relation to our client's projects.**Duties and responsibilities include**:

- Support the wider team in the implementation of community and stakeholder engagement requirements across a portfolio of wind and solar projects.
- To competently and positively represent our client to local communities and stakeholders, through written, phone and in-person communications.
- Enhance our client's positive reputation as a wind farm developer by providing information and liaising with the local communities.
- Support the Communications Manager by providing project information for corporate communications activities such as political engagements, press releases and branding activities.

**Experience/Qualifications**:

- Tertiary qualification with a minimum of two years of experience in community engagement, community relations, stakeholder management in the renewable energy or relevant other industry.
- Experience of implementing community engagement strategies.
- Experience of liaising with local communities and a wide variety of stakeholders.
- Knowledge of effective community engagement principles and techniques for rural communities.

**About the client**:
Our client offers comprehensive wind power solutions, including investment, construction, and operational and maintenance services.
